介绍 随着区块链技术的不断发展,越来越多的企业开始探索区块链应用的可能性。而选择一个适合自己的区块链平台...
随着数字化时代的到来,区块链技术因其去中心化和高安全性而逐渐受到关注。搭建一个高效的区块链平台不仅可以为企业带来创新,还可以供应链、支付和身份验证等业务流程。本文将深入探讨如何搭建一个高效的区块链平台,涵盖所需技术、工具、实施步骤以及常见挑战。
在开始搭建区块链平台之前,了解不同类型的区块链是至关重要的。区块链可以分为公有链、私有链和联盟链,它们各自有不同的应用场景和优势。
公有链是完全开放给所有用户的区块链,任何人都可以参与网络。比特币和以太坊就是著名的公有链示例,适用于透明性要求高的应用。
私有链则由单一组织控制,适合需要较高数据隐私和安全性的应用场景,如企业内部交易。
联盟链则是多个组织共同管理的区块链,结合了公有链和私有链的优点,适用于各方合作的场合。
搭建一个区块链平台通常包括以下几个步骤:
首先,明确项目的目标和需求,确定平台的功能模块和用户角色。
选择适合的区块链技术栈,比如以太坊、Hyperledger Fabric或者Corda。
设计平台架构,包括节点部署、网络拓扑和数据存储方案。
进行智能合约的编写与部署,确保应用的安全性与稳定性。
在生产环境中部署区块链平台,并进行持续的监控和维护。
搭建区块链平台并非易事,常见挑战包括技术复杂性、人才短缺和法律法规的不确定性。
区块链技术的复杂性要求团队具有多样的技能,包括加密学、分布式计算和网络安全等领域的知识。
市场上优秀的区块链开发者仍然稀缺,企业需要投入资源培养团队,或考虑外包技术开发。
不同国家的法律法规对区块链的监管政策不尽相同,企业在搭建平台前需要深入研究相关法规。
搭建区块链平台的成本因多个因素而异,包括技术选型、开发周期、人才成本,以及后续运维费用。
一般而言,使用开源框架如Hyperledger的成本相对较低,然而如果需要定制开发或使用高价的云服务,成本将大幅上升。
此外,企业需要考虑长期的维护和升级费用,以确保系统的安全和稳定。
选择合适的区块链平台需要根据业务需求、技术架构和团队能力进行综合评估。
例如,如果企业注重交易的隐私性,可能会选择私有链。而如果需要实现透明和公开的目标,公有链则是更好的选择。进行市场调研,结合实际案例分析,有助于作出更明智的决策。
区块链技术正在多个领域获得应用,包括金融、物流、医疗、供应链管理等。
在金融领域,区块链可以实现跨境支付和清算;物流行业则利用区块链实现物品来源可追溯;医疗行业可以利用区块链来管理患者数据和医疗记录,提升数据的安全性和可访问性。
未来区块链平台将会出现多种趋势,包括与人工智能、物联网等其它技术的深度融合。
此外,随着监管政策的日益明确,区块链的ICO模式以及数字资产的合法化将逐步推进。而新兴的零知识证明等技术将为区块链平台带来更高的隐私性和安全性,推动其在更多行业的广泛应用。
总结搭建高效的区块链平台需要综合考虑技术选择、业务需求和市场环境。尽管面临一些挑战,通过合理的风险管理和技术选型,企业能够实现数字化转型的成功。同时,伴随着技术的发展,区块链平台的应用前景将愈加广阔,值得企业投资与探索。
请根据这个框架进一步完善内容,使其达到4200字的要求。